How much does a civil engineer earn in Odenton, MD?

The average civil engineer in Odenton, MD earns between $50,000 and $88,000 annually. This compares to the national average civil engineer range of $51,000 to $97,000.

Average civil engineer salary in Odenton, MD

$66,000
